HORTUS NYC Introduce
HORTUS NYC, located in the dynamic Nomad neighborhood, is a culinary gem that offers a sophisticated and modern take on Asian cuisine. The restaurant, whose name is Latin for “garden,” embodies this concept with its lush, multi-level interior and a focus on fresh, high-quality ingredients. It’s an upscale and trendy dining destination that stands out for its unique blend of Korean, Chinese, and Thai flavors, all presented with an artful and contemporary flair. HORTUS NYC is not just a place to eat; it's an experience, with a romantic and cozy atmosphere that makes it a perfect setting for a date night, a special celebration, or a memorable dinner with friends.
The menu at HORTUS NYC is a testament to inventive and refined fusion cooking. While you'll find classic flavors, they are often re-imagined in creative and delicious ways. A standout feature is the **3 Course Tasting** menu, which offers an excellent value and a curated journey through the kitchen's best offerings. Must-try dishes include the **Truffle Donabe**, a rich and earthy clay pot rice with wild mushrooms, and the **Wagyu Sotbap**, featuring premium A5 Miyazaki Wagyu. The restaurant also offers an impressive selection of other dishes, from fresh raw seafood like oysters and the **HORTUS Royal Platter** to satisfying mains such as the **Short Rib** and **Duck**. For pasta lovers, the Korean-inspired pasta dishes like the **Black Garlic Cacio e Pepe** and **Korean Smoked Pasta** are an unexpected and delightful surprise.
Beyond the food, HORTUS NYC provides a truly elevated dining experience. The ambiance is consistently praised by patrons for being both intimate and romantic, with a dimly lit space and a glass-enclosed "hidden garden" area that offers a cozy, private feel. The service is described as attentive and knowledgeable, with staff ready to explain the intricacies of each dish and offer thoughtful recommendations. While the prices can be on the higher side, many customers feel the quality of the food and the overall experience justify the cost. The restaurant is a popular spot for both lunch and dinner, and its location and unique atmosphere make it a perfect spot for various occasions, from a casual outing to a more formal gathering.
HORTUS NYC also offers a great beverage program. Due to its location across from a church, the restaurant focuses on wine, beer, and a creative list of cocktails made with soju or sake. This unique constraint has led to an innovative and enjoyable drink menu. The restaurant's dedication to providing a full sensory experience is also evident in its occasional live jazz nights, adding a layer of sophistication and entertainment to your meal. ★ 5★ 4★ 3★ 2★ 1The presentation of the dishes is nice, but the taste is average. The ingredients, especially the seafood, were not very fresh and had a slightly fishy smell. The flavors were on the salty side. The restaurant’s ventilation isn’t great, so you can smell the cooking fumes.The servers provided good service, but the way the restaurant charges tips is confusing. They give you a so-called complimentary “bite food,” but don’t tell you that the tip calculation will be based on a bill that includes the $40 “gift,” which honestly isn’t worth even $10. For example, if you order $100 worth of food and choose 25% tip on the card machine, your tip will actually be calculated on $140, meaning you end up paying $35 in tips—effectively 35%—without realizing it unless you check carefully.
August 18 · JaneHortus NYC is a hidden gem in NoMad, offering a modern take on Korean-inspired dishes that are both flavorful and inventive.One of the standout features is their tasting menu, which offers excellent value for the quality of food. The salmon crudo and waygu gui are must-try starters, both bursting with freshness. For mains, the duck breast is tender, and perfectly cooked, the truffle donabe and waygu sotbap are rich and delicious.The ambiance is intimate, making it an ideal spot for date nights or small gatherings. Service is attentive but never intrusive, and the staff is knowledgeable about both the menu.DRINKS: because they are located across from a church, they do NOT serve hard liquor. They have wine, beer, and cocktails are either sake or soju-based. Still a great selection!
June 19 · Sid KoWent for an early dinner on a Thursday and ordered the 3 dish set. The oyster and salmon was very fresh. The sauce on the salmon dish was watery but it tasted better than it looked. The wagyu for the 2nd dish was average. The Wagyu Sotbap was good and worth the extra $10. Although it was heavy because the oil from cooking the wagyu with a blow torch was absorbed by the rice. The duck was also very flavorful and nicely cooked. Overall, we enjoyed the all the dishes. The cocktails (5th Ave) was eh.
